对象存储服务器是什么,深入解析对象存储服务器,原理、应用与优势
- 综合资讯
- 2024-10-18 05:32:53
- 2

对象存储服务器是一种用于存储和管理大量数据的服务器,通过将数据封装成对象进行存储。其原理是将数据、元数据及存储位置封装成一个对象,并通过唯一的键来访问。应用广泛,如云计...
对象存储服务器是一种基于对象模型的存储架构,以对象为单位进行数据存储。它通过文件名、元数据、数据块和存储路径等元素来管理数据。该服务器具有高扩展性、高效性、低成本等优势,广泛应用于大数据、云计算等领域。其原理基于HTTP协议,通过封装数据为对象,实现数据的分布式存储和访问。
随着互联网技术的飞速发展,数据存储需求日益增长,传统的文件存储服务器已无法满足大规模、高性能、低成本的数据存储需求,对象存储服务器作为一种新型的数据存储技术,逐渐成为业界关注的焦点,本文将从对象存储服务器的定义、原理、应用和优势等方面进行深入解析。
对象存储服务器是什么?
对象存储服务器(Object Storage Server,简称OSS)是一种基于对象模型的数据存储技术,与传统的文件存储服务器相比,对象存储服务器将数据存储在一系列无固定结构、无路径依赖的对象中,每个对象包含数据、元数据和存储位置信息,这种存储方式具有以下特点:
1、数据粒度小:对象存储服务器将数据划分为最小的存储单元——对象,每个对象包含一定量的数据,便于管理和访问。
2、高扩展性:对象存储服务器采用分布式架构,可以轻松实现横向扩展,满足大规模数据存储需求。
3、高可用性:对象存储服务器采用多副本、数据冗余等机制,确保数据的高可靠性。
4、高性能:对象存储服务器支持并发访问,具备较高的读写性能。
5、良好的兼容性:对象存储服务器支持多种编程语言和开发工具,便于应用开发和集成。
对象存储服务器的原理
1、数据存储模型:对象存储服务器采用对象存储模型,将数据存储在一系列无固定结构、无路径依赖的对象中,每个对象包含以下部分:
(1)数据:实际存储的数据内容。
(2)元数据:描述对象属性的信息,如创建时间、修改时间、访问权限等。
(3)存储位置:对象在存储系统中的具体位置。
2、分布式架构:对象存储服务器采用分布式架构,将数据分散存储在多个节点上,这种架构具有以下优势:
(1)提高数据可靠性:数据分布在多个节点上,即使某个节点发生故障,其他节点仍然可以提供服务。
(2)提高性能:数据可以并行读取和写入,提高读写性能。
(3)降低单点故障风险:分布式架构降低了单点故障的风险,提高了系统的可用性。
3、数据冗余:对象存储服务器采用多副本、数据冗余等机制,确保数据的高可靠性,具体实现方式如下:
(1)数据复制:将数据复制到多个节点上,提高数据的可靠性。
(2)数据校验:对数据进行校验,确保数据的一致性。
(3)数据删除:当检测到数据损坏时,自动删除损坏的数据,并从副本中恢复。
对象存储服务器的应用
1、云存储:对象存储服务器是云计算的核心技术之一,广泛应用于云存储服务中,用户可以将数据存储在云对象存储中,实现数据的集中管理和便捷访问。
2、大数据存储:对象存储服务器具有高扩展性和高性能,适用于大数据场景,用户可以将海量数据存储在对象存储服务器中,便于数据分析和挖掘。
3、数字资产存储:对象存储服务器适用于存储各类数字资产,如图片、视频、音频等,企业可以将数字资产存储在对象存储服务器中,实现资产的集中管理和高效利用。
4、物联网:对象存储服务器可以用于存储物联网设备产生的海量数据,如传感器数据、设备日志等,用户可以将数据存储在对象存储服务器中,实现数据的实时监控和分析。
对象存储服务器的优势
1、高性能:对象存储服务器支持并发访问,具备较高的读写性能,满足大规模数据存储需求。
2、高可靠性:对象存储服务器采用多副本、数据冗余等机制,确保数据的高可靠性。
3、高扩展性:对象存储服务器采用分布式架构,可以轻松实现横向扩展,满足大规模数据存储需求。
4、低成本:对象存储服务器采用通用硬件和开源软件,降低了存储成本。
5、良好的兼容性:对象存储服务器支持多种编程语言和开发工具,便于应用开发和集成。
对象存储服务器作为一种新型的数据存储技术,具有高性能、高可靠性、高扩展性等优点,随着互联网技术的不断发展,对象存储服务器将在云计算、大数据、物联网等领域发挥越来越重要的作用,了解对象存储服务器的原理、应用和优势,有助于我们更好地利用这一技术,推动数据存储产业的发展。
本文链接:https://www.zhitaoyun.cn/156627.html
发表评论